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00395 3105466582 70131940260 80974 35873041
0693652967 53199330169 945
0693652967 53199330169 945
490605 93605 45828900744 46328 5495037
All about undefined
Interested in learning more?
0693652967 53199330169 945
490605 93605 45828900744 46328 5495037
See more
32167611742 648
9950185361 386962090 538
See more
037407591 20148987 87
00099523 494370 89
See more